Overview of the Market:
The Axial Flow Pump Market comprises pumps specifically designed to move large volumes of fluid at low pressure, making them ideal for irrigation, flood control, drainage, cooling water circulation, wastewater treatment, power plants, and industrial applications. Growing urbanization, climate resilience initiatives, and agricultural modernization are increasing the deployment of axial flow pumps worldwide. Technological advancements in corrosion-resistant materials, intelligent monitoring systems, and energy-efficient designs are further accelerating market growth.
Market Size & Growth: The global axial flow pump market is projected to reach USD 7.86 billion by 2036, registering a CAGR of 5.1% between 2026 and 2036.

SWOT Analysis:
Strengths:
- High flow capacity with excellent hydraulic efficiency.
- Reliable performance for low-head applications.
- Broad industrial and agricultural applications.
Weaknesses:
- Limited suitability for high-pressure systems.
- Higher maintenance under abrasive operating conditions.
- Installation requires significant infrastructure investment.
